Range Rover 3.9 V8 Vogue SE ‘Soft Dash’ 1994 Automatic (1995 model – one of the last) – Grey with grey leather interior. Runs on petrol and LPG and has a current M.O.T.

I’ve owned the vehicle since March 2020 and it was purchased as a non-runner having being stood for some considerable time. I managed to get it running and I’ve spent the last 4 years playing with it and doing odds & sods. In that time it’s had various items including a new viscous fan coupling, water pump and radiator, it’s also had a new dizzy cap, plug leads, ignition coil and electronic ignition fitted plus a new air flow meter. It’s had a new rear exhaust box for the recent MOT and the old dicky starter motor has been replaced with a new one on 19/03/2024.

It has an original Land Rover Jack Kit complete with bottle jack, two stage handle, wheel brace and chocks.

It has ‘gas’ fitted (tank in the boot) and runs okay on it, **changing from petrol to gas is not a problem however, it hates going from gas to petrol and mis-fires badly, you have to stop, turn her off and wait a couple of minutes before starting on petrol again. As long as you’re aware there’s a problem it’s just a minor inconvenience. This is only a recent occurrence and I’ll let someone else find out why.

There is a V8 Range Rover classic, 14CUX ECU USB diagnostic lead (Rover-Gauge – ‘Hot Wire’) and CD with vehicle as well as a workshop manual for the 1994 model, there are slight changes to this 1995 model and so I would advise downloading the ‘Range Rover Electrical troubleshooting manual 1995 model’ and the ‘Range Rover Classic workshop manual 1995 model’.
